Resiliency & Transition Support for Military Child & Youth Program Professionals
Solicitation # N4571A-26-R-0010
Commander, Navy Installations Command is seeking a contractor to provide comprehensive transition and resiliency programming for military-connected youth and Child and Youth Program professionals across Navy, Air Force, and Army Reserve installations. The program will deliver in-person and virtual training, webinars, digital resources, and physical materials designed to equip youth leaders with peer-to-peer resiliency tools to support children through critical life changes such as relocation, deployment, and reintegration. The contract is structured as a Firm-Fixed-Price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) with a base period from October 1, 2026, through September 30, 2027, and up to nine one-year option periods extending performance through September 30, 2036. The estimated total contract value ranges from $4.68 million to a ceiling of $34.86 million if all options are exercised, with each option year having a specified ceiling amount. Deliverables include structured training curricula and resource materials developed in accordance with DoD directives including OPNAVINST 1700.9e CH-1, DoDI 6060.02, and DoDI 6060.04, and all materials created under the contract become government property. Physical resources are delivered FOB destination to military installations within 30 days of order receipt, while digital materials are delivered electronically within seven business days. Award will be made through a trade-off process that prioritizes technical capability, key personnel qualifications, and past performance over price, with technical capability being significantly more important than the other factors. Proposals must include detailed technical and price volumes submitted electronically as PDFs, with the technical proposal limited to 30 pages excluding resumes, certifications, and quality control plans. Offerors must provide CAGE codes, confirm accurate size status in SAM, and complete mandatory representations regarding debarment, covered telecommunications equipment, and ownership disclosures. All contractor personnel require a minimum NACI clearance and must obtain and maintain a Civilian Access Card, complete mandatory DoD security training, and participate in annual refresher courses. Key personnel must have a Bachelor’s degree or three years of relevant experience, and their resumes must be submitted with the proposal; replacements require prior COR approval. Invoicing is performed monthly in arrears to the designated COR using specified accounting identifiers under Nonappropriated Funds, with no U.S. appropriated funds obligated. Full Description

Show more
The contractor will design and/or deliver two virtual wellness courses for 300 employees. Each course will be offered once during the period of performance. The courses will be delivered through the U.S. Department of Education's Microsoft Teams platform.
